Mary Driscoll Obituary

Mary Elizabeth Driscoll
06/04/1943 - 04/29/2025
Mary was born in San Francisco to Mary Theresa and Timothy Joseph Driscoll (both deceased). She lived a life filled with love, humor, and adventure.
She is survived by her partner Mark Schapira, siblings Carol Cogliandro, James Driscoll, and Kathleen Mino. Marybeth is preceded in death by her siblings Timothy Driscoll, John Driscoll, Joan Allen, and Monica Driscoll. As a devoted aunt, Marybeth shared a special bond with her nieces/grandnieces and nephews/grandnephews, always eager to learn of and participate in their individual lives and activities.
Marybeth was an educator at heart; whether teaching in the classroom, helping aspiring teachers attain their credentials at USF, or sharing her knowledge with others, she was a proponent of all forms of education. She was brilliant and embodied lifelong learning with flair and curiosity, and a healthy dose of sass. For anyone who knew her, she was also always right (as she loved to attest to!) Whether diving into a spirited political debate, jetting off to new destinations, devouring the latest novel, or dressing in the latest fashion, she did it all with style and spark. Marybeth's ability for connecting with people, and generously sharing her sharp insights, left an unforgettable mark on everyone lucky enough to have known her.
A celebration of Marybeth's life will be held at St. Brendan's Catholic Church on Friday, May 16th, at 10 a.m. In lieu of flowers, please donate to Vision of Hope, Mercy Burlingame, or Archbishop Riordan.
